Title: Wanprestasi terhadap Akta Perjanjian Pengikatan Jual Beli Tanah dan Bangunan (Studi Putusan Nomor 522/Pdt.G/2021/Pn-Mdn)
Other Titles: Default of Performance Against The Deed of Binding Sale and Purchase Agreement of Land and Building (Study of Decision Number 522/Pdt.G/2021/PN-Mdn)

Abstract: Penelitian ini bertujuan untuk menganalisis wanprestasi dalam Perjanjian Pengikatan Jual Beli tanah dan bangunan yang dibuat di bawah tangan, mengkaji peran sertifikat hak milik sebagai penguat perikatan, serta mengevaluasi efektivitas putusan pengadilan dalam memberikan kepastian hukum berdasarkan Putusan Pengadilan Negeri Medan Nomor 522Pdt.G/2021/PN.Mdn. Masalah difokuskan pada kelalaian pembeli yang berhenti membayar angsuran setelah menerima somasi tertulis, keabsahan perjanjian di bawah tangan yang memenuhi empat syarat sah perjanjian, serta implikasi hukum pembatalan perjanjian dengan pengembalian 50 persen dari uang muka yang telah dibayar sesuai klausul perjanjian. Guna mendekati masalah ini dipergunakan acuan teori dari Kitab Undang-Undang Hukum Perdata tentang syarat sah perjanjian, wanprestasi, dan akibat hukumnya termasuk kewajiban ganti rugi serta pembatalan perjanjian timbal balik. Data-data dikumpulkan melalui studi kepustakaan terhadap peraturan perundang-undangan dan doktrin hukum perdata, analisis mendalam putusan pengadilan, wawancara dengan hakim Pengadilan Negeri Medan, serta pemeriksaan dokumen perkara lengkap, dan dianalisis secara kualitatif normatif. Kajian ini menyimpulkan bahwa perjanjian di bawah tangan memilikikekuatan hukum mengikat apabila memenuhi syarat kesepakatan, kecakapan, objek tertentu, dan sebab yang halal sebagaimana Pasal 1320 Kitab Undang-Undang Hukum Perdata, sertifikat hak milik berfungsi sebagai bukti kuat legitimasi perikatan meskipun dibuat di bawah tangan, serta putusan verstek pengadilan efektif melindungi pihak penjual melalui pembatalan perjanjian dan penetapan pengembalian uang secara proporsional sesuai kesepakatan awal para pihak. This research aims to analyze default of performance in the Binding Sale and Purchase Agreement of land and building made under private deed, examine the role of ownership certificates as reinforcement of legal binding, and evaluate the effectiveness of court decisions in providing legal certainty based on the Decision of the Medan District Court Number 522/Pdt.G/2021/PN.Mdn. The problem is focused on the negligence of the buyer who stopped paying installments after receiving a written warning, the validity of the private agreement that fulfills the four legal requirements of a valid agreement, as well as the legal implications of contract cancellation with the return of 50 percent of the down payment that has been paid in accordance with the agreement clause. In order to approach this problem, theoretical references from the Civil Code regarding the legal requirements of agreements, default of performance, and its legal consequences including compensation obligations and cancellation of reciprocal agreements were used. The data were collected through literature study of statutory regulations and civil law doctrines, in-depth analysis of court decisions, interviews with judges of the Medan District Court, as well as examination of complete case documents, and were analyzed normatively and qualitatively. This study concludes that private agreements have binding legal force if they fulfill the requirements of agreement, legal capacity, a certain object, and a lawful cause as regulated in Article 1320 of the Civil Code, ownership certificates function as strong evidence of the legitimacy of legal binding even though they are made under private deed, and default court decisions effectively protect the seller through contract cancellation and determination of proportional refund of funds in accordance with the initial agreement of the parties.
